The thyroid cancer screening explained

The thyroid cancer screening explained Thyroid cancer screening is an important aspect of early detection and management of this increasingly common form of cancer. The thyroid, a butterfly-shaped gland located at the base of the neck, plays a crucial role in regulating metabolism through hormone production. While thyroid cancer is relatively rare compared to other cancers, its incidence has been rising, partly due to improved detection methods. Understanding how screening works, who should consider it, and its benefits and limitations can help individuals make informed health decisions.

Typically, thyroid cancer screening is not recommended for the general population without symptoms, as the disease often presents without early warning signs. Instead, screening is usually reserved for individuals at higher risk, including those with a family history of thyroid cancer, exposure to radiation (especially during childhood), or certain genetic conditions that predispose to thyroid malignancies. In these cases, proactive screening can facilitate early diagnosis, which generally correlates with better treatment outcomes.

The primary screening tools for thyroid cancer include physical examination and imaging techniques. During a physical exam, healthcare professionals check for any lumps, enlarged lymph nodes, or irregularities in the thyroid gland. While a palpable lump may raise suspicion, it does not confirm cancer, as benign nodules are common. Therefore, imaging studies like ultrasound are essential for further evaluation. Thyroid ultrasound is a non-invasive, highly sensitive method that can detect even small nodules that may be missed during a physical exam. Ultrasound helps determine the size, composition (solid or cystic), and characteristics of nodules, which guides the subsequent steps.

In addition to ultrasound, blood tests measuring thyroid hormone levels and markers like calcitonin may be performed, particularly if there’s suspicion of medullary thyroid cancer. However, these tests are not definitive screening tools themselves but can provide supplementary information. When a suspicious nodule is identified, a fine-needle aspiration biopsy (FNAB) is usually performed. In this minimally invasive procedure, a thin needle extracts cells from the nodule for cytological examination. The biopsy results help determine whether the nodule is benign or malignant, guiding further management.

It’s important to note that screening for thyroid cancer has some limitations. False positives can lead to unnecessary biopsies or surgeries, while false negatives might delay diagnosis. Moreover, not all detected nodules are cancerous, and many grow slowly or remain asymptomatic for years. Consequently, the decision to screen should be individualized based on risk factors and clinical judgment.

In summary, thyroid cancer screening involves a combination of physical examination, ultrasound imaging, and sometimes blood tests and biopsy procedures. It is primarily targeted at individuals with known risk factors and should be approached judiciously to avoid overdiagnosis and overtreatment. Early detection through appropriate screening can significantly improve outcomes, but it requires a balanced understanding of the benefits and limitations.

Regular consultations with healthcare providers are essential for those at increased risk, ensuring that screening and follow-up protocols are appropriately tailored. As research advances, more accurate and less invasive screening tools may become available, further aiding in the fight against thyroid cancer.
